Transaction d2144362d9962b2879514f01b22380d453554bd62b2d5469bc3427e9d4f67663
1 Input
1 Output
-
d2144362d9962b2879514f01b22380d453554bd62b2d5469bc3427e9d4f67663:0
- value
- 45900
- script pubkey
- OP_0 OP_PUSHBYTES_20 e42202ad1afd3a81bd329612bae748cec8b7ec74
- address
- bc1qus3q9tg6l5agr0fjjcft4e6gemyt0mr5vq0dma